Warframe Cloud

 A Frame Suit fitted with it's own Cephalon (Like a ship with it's own Cephalon, sure it can speak, but it can't man the entire ship alone. Just like Jordas trapped on an infested ship, this is a Cephalon stuck in a war machine just collecting data as it flies by. She can only detach so far before being pulled right back to it). Cephalon Cloud projects herself with a passion for the round swirly free forming shapes of Clouds. Just like the frames digital clouds.

Cephalon Cloud communicates with her Tenno through shapes to express her emotions rather then Dialect like English.
She believes it to be more efficient and productive.

She wasn't always like this.

 

Passive: Killing Enemies causes them to drop disapproval Data Cubes. While allowing your teammates to kill Enemies for you drops Approval Data Cubes.

 

Abilities.

1. Sneak past your enemies by mimicking Objects that have been fully scanned in your Object Codex. (Or troll with your friends  ¯\_(ツ)_/¯ )

2. Use the internal scanner on Clouds wrist to scan an enemy and learn personal information on them. Then Lure your foes away by mimicking that very idea. (A randomly generated quirk system would need to be implemented for this, but I think it be so funny to lure a wave of grineer because they idolize the hottest Ballista in their ranks or even worse.)

_

3. Disapproval Kills build up Cephalons Clouds Negative Data Base. Watch as your Cephalon detaches from your frame and decimates the health of enemies around you in one clean wipe. (Advised not to use with other fellow warframes around).

4. Approval Kills build up Cephalon Clouds Positive Data Base. Unleash this data at max to give your fellow warframes a holographic copy of themselves that will copy their every move. Even their damage output. However, Warframes that die or fall in death pits will lose their privilege to this copy until used again.

 

If it's not clear.

Cephalon Clouds true nature is letting others do the work for her. She's not impressed with the do it yourself. But rather the latter. Believing that it's only wiser to be able to do so little and, yet gain so much. Cephalon Cloud admires the tactic of observing and replicating the most efficient ways of all to reach her true end goal. Giving wait to why warframes that fail by dying or falling into death pits lose their privilege of such a replicated copy. They are not worthy or efficient in Clouds perception.

Had a few similar skill conceps for a shadow based frame I did a while ago ( if you are curios Sombra ) so here my feedback on your kit. 

3 hours ago, (PS4)Papa_ApplePie said:

Passive: Killing Enemies causes them to drop disapproval Data Cubes. While allowing your teammates to kill Enemies for you drops Approval Data Cubes.

I like unique resourses because they are better at creating a unique gameplay loop than energy. You should add a second passive that allows the frame to do something while you are using your operator even if that something is dacing because you know it would be odd for the cephalon to just idle while the operator is out. Having two passives is not uncomon for example atlas has 2 , sure footed and his armor , inaros also has 2 healing on finsihers and turning into a cofin upon death.

3 hours ago, (PS4)Papa_ApplePie said:

1. Sneak past your enemies by mimicking Objects that have been fully scanned in your Object Codex. (Or troll with your friends  ¯\_(ツ)_/¯ )

This is bad invisibility ( does not allow you to fire your weapons or melee) , add a bonus perk after the end of the tranformation.

3 hours ago, (PS4)Papa_ApplePie said:

2. Use the internal scanner on Clouds wrist to scan an enemy and learn personal information on them. Then Lure your foes away by mimicking that very idea. (A randomly generated quirk system would need to be implemented for this, but I think it be so funny to lure a wave of grineer because they idolize the hottest Ballista in their ranks or even worse.)

This is a fancier ivara noise arrow ,once again add something else to it like it turns into their wrost nightmare upon recast or blows up.

3 hours ago, (PS4)Papa_ApplePie said:

. Disapproval Kills build up Cephalons Clouds Negative Data Base. Watch as your Cephalon detaches from your frame and decimates the health of enemies around you in one clean wipe. (Advised not to use with other fellow warframes around).

It an aoe nuke , it is fine because it relies on a unique resource intead of energy. 

3 hours ago, (PS4)Papa_ApplePie said:

4. Approval Kills build up Cephalon Clouds Positive Data Base. Unleash this data at max to give your fellow warframes a holographic copy of themselves that will copy their every move. Even their damage output. However, Warframes that die or fall in death pits will lose their privilege to this copy until used again.

That´t the skill similar to sombra , her passive allows her to copy an ally loudout by pressing X at then , her 2 allows her to create a copy of herself that repeats all her actions with a small delay. So you could be 2 copies of your ally. But back at the topic at hand this is skill is really good , mulshot for warframe but there is a problem this skill is literally disabled during solo play, so you should either created a way to gain aproval solo and copy herself or give the skill a secondary effect if there is no aproval during cast. 

 

Overall created a quite creative concept
